Subject: Handover — nightly search reindex

Hi team,

I'm handing off the nightly reindex job for the Lanternfish search cluster. It kicks off at 02:15 and normally finishes in about forty minutes. If it runs past 04:00, kill it and rerun with the `--partial` flag rather than letting it block the morning ETL. Logs land in the usual ops bucket under `reindex/`. The job reads from the catalog replica, which you can reach with the connection string below.

primary connection of kajop-yahap = postgresql://pelax_svc:EQ@db-49fe.tolvaqgrid.example:5432/zormir

Ticket: Config drift on the Lanewise address autocomplete widget. The staging and prod clusters have diverged again — prod still throttles suggestions per keystroke while staging uses the newer debounce model, which explains the mismatched bug reports. Future maintainers: do not hand-edit prod. Canonical settings live in the widget repo and should be synced verbatim. For reference, prod currently runs with these values:

settings of fafog-haduf:
ZORIX_PIN=4648
ZORIX_METRICS_HOST=metrics.zorix.paliqsys.corp
ZORIX_LOG_LEVEL=info
ZORIX_TENANT=druix

Handover — Petra to incoming coordinator. Master key set for the Windrow Court estate goes out first thing. Keys are in the grey lockbox, sealed, count verified at 14 keys. Do not log the set on the open manifest; it travels as "maintenance parcel." One driver only, no subcontracting, no stops. Recipient is the estate facilities manager in person — not reception, not a deputy. Driver calls the desk before departure and after delivery. Give the courier the hand-over instruction stated below.

handover note for tafog-bawef: the ulair kasael courier leaves the ralok gilmir fenael druwyn feneth queniel belix keliel ledger at gate 5216 under passcode 961436